Today, market participants may be sitting on the edge of their seats in anticipation of the US retail sales for October, where substantial numbers could add to speculation that the Fed could indeed start raising interest rates as soon as the tapering process is over. Tomorrow, during the early European morning, we get the UK CPIs, with further acceleration having the potential to fuel bets over a December hike by the Bank of England (BoE).h2 US Retail Sales Today and UK CPIs Early Tomorrow on the Agenda/h2

The US dollar traded higher against all but one of the other major currencies on Monday and during the Asian morning Tuesday. It lost some ground only versus CAD, while the main losers were EUR and CHF.
